Clifton Melvin
President
Clifton was elected as president in July 2010 after having been Chairman of the club from September 2006. He will continue his work with our local council to seek more grounds for the club.
A Spurs fan, like his predecessor Barry Plested, he appreciates the beautiful game and understands how to lose as well as win! High on his agenda is the challenge of expanding the facilities and infrastructure at CCYFC as the club enjoys an ever increasing membership.

His involvement with the club began when his elder son Simon started playing in Barry’s team in the mid ‘90’s and Clifton began to help with coaching and refereeing when his younger son Tim began playing. He then assisted Roger Killick with coaching when Simon played in Roger’s team. Not having played football since the age of 11 he decided a refresher course was a good idea and in March 2001 successfully completed the Junior Team Manager’s course.

In the summer of 2001, a group of then U 11 parents decided to start a new 11-a-side team and Clifton was “volunteered” to manage Chorleywood Phoenix as he had the coaching qualification! His organising and delegating instincts came to the fore as he co-opted 4 other parents to help run the team. In 2005 he initiated the development of the club’s website, which he sees as crucial to the way we manage CCYFC and communicate with each other.

Clifton has enjoyed a successful career in financial services, having been the Chief Executive of insurance companies in both Spain and the UK. He is currently a Director of AIM-listed company Just Retirement plc and Chairman of EcoHydra Technologies Limited.
